Sandra Bullock had hour phone call with ‘Practical Magic’ author’s son for the sweetest reason

Sandra Bullock may have been busy with magic and spells on “Practical Magic,” but she did take time out of her busy schedule to do a selfless act.According to Alice Hoffman — the author of the 1995 novel of the same name — the Oscar winner reached out to her son when he was too sick to visit the set.“I don’t know how old he was at that time, but he was maybe 10 or 11.

He couldn’t go on the set,” Hoffman, 71, recalls to the Post. “Sandra Bullock called him at the hotel and talked to him for an hour. [That says] everything about who she is and her generosity.

That was kind of that personal moment for me that was the best part of the filming.”She adds: “She’s just extremely generous and kind and knew that he was disappointed that he couldn’t go on the set.”Bullock, 59, stars in the Griffin Dunne-directed drama alongside Nicole Kidman, Stockard Channing and Dianne Wiest.

Centered on the Owens family, witches Sally (Bullock) and Gillian (Kidman) try to find love despite being threatened by a curse — all while living under the same roof as their eccentric aunts (Channing and Wiest).Hoffman credits Bullock for making the film adaptation a reality.“I felt like she’s the reason that [it got] made — that she decided to do it and she made it happen.
